你查询的IP:[114.80.1.181]  地理位置:中国–上海–上海电信/IDC机房

最新查询123.96.193.33 210.78.162.195 121.46.191.102 221.200.5.160 222.128.76.84 58.128.233.209 218.96.127.97 222.64.236.132 120.2.138.123 114.80.1.181 59.155.210.140 125.96.235.244 122.8.74.230 58.87.64.16 210.51.14.135 60.200.14.39 202.44.110.92 202.122.21.111 118.248.7.138 117.57.167.239 203.95.246.112 210.185.192.17 210.12.184.19 211.136.35.8 124.156.19.38 118.88.64.130 119.161.128.173 222.32.65.179 124.6.64.86 202.164.240.47 221.199.65.163